yep, one developer proposed an 'affordable' development that would have trashed all of the codes for setbacks, yard size, parking, etc. Didn't pass as the surrounding neighborhoods raised h*ll saying this level of density would hurt property values, increase traffic, etc. Prices still exceeded 'affordable' - defined as the payments for a person making the county-wide median family income could not exceed 30% of income, and they were the same, 3 story, tall skinny homes with no basements and almost no yard, save a 'common area' green space. Funny, they said would appeal to seniors since the tiny yards would be easy to maintain, but my parents downsized due to trouble navigating the stairs when they were in their 70's. - how many seniors want all those stairs a 3 story home would have?!
